Output ebec2fc13c2dcf27d4072c9c5601316865eee09ce0309993b420eb8d9ce790d5:1

value
47791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373e76c39f66182e7fdfe3e610b80756be91d OP_EQUAL
address
3BMEX5ZuRA2Q8fsQeVAqDkUKDyRu7JEtFq
transaction
ebec2fc13c2dcf27d4072c9c5601316865eee09ce0309993b420eb8d9ce790d5
confirmations
317579
spent
true